CHEVRON OIL COMPANY v. BARLOW

No. 10147.

406 F.2d 687 (1969)

CHEVRON OIL COMPANY, formerly California Oil Company, a California corporation, Appellant, v. Fred L. BARLOW, Helen M. Barlow, and the Anschutz Corporation, Inc., a Kansas corporation, Appellees.

United States Court of Appeals Tenth Circuit.

Rehearing Denied March 17, 1969.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Patrick M. Westfeldt, of Holland & Hart, Denver, Colo., (James A. Tilker, of Kline & Tilker, Cheyenne, Wyo., and William E. Barton, of Brown, Drew, Apostolos, Barton & Massey, Casper, Wyo., on the brief), for appellant.

Robert Martin, of Martin, Porter, Pringle, Schell & Fair, Wichita, Kan., (Thomas M. Burns, of Burns & Wall, Denver, Colo., on the brief), for appellee, The Anschutz Corp., Inc.

Wade Brorby, of Morgan & Brorby, Gillette, Wyo., on brief for appellees, Fred L. Barlow and Helen M. Barlow.

Before MURRAH, PICKETT and HOLLOWAY, Circuit Judges.


PICKETT, Circuit Judge.

Chevron Oil Company, formerly California Oil Company, holder of an oil and gas lease comprising approximately 2,000 acres on land in Campbell County, Wyoming owned by Fred L. and Helen M. Barlow, instituted this action seeking a determination and declaration that its lease is valid and the subsequent lease to appellee, the Anschutz Corporation, Inc., is invalid, and other relief.
